National «Archives for School» Campaign at the Belarusian State Archives and Museum of Literature and Art (BSAMLI)

On May 13, 2026, as part of the national «Archives for School» campaign, a tour was held at the Belarusian State Archives and Museum of Literature and Art (hereinafter referred to as BSAMLI) for first-year students of Group TM-511 of the Belarusian State Academy of Communications.

The tour was led by V.V. Birulya, Head of the Information, Publication, and Document Use Department at BSAMLI. She described the rich history of the archives and museum building, a former Bernardine church and an architectural treasure.

The guests also learned about the archives and museum’s main activities and the archivists’ work in preserving the documentary heritage of Belarusian literature and art.

The participants also visited the reading room, where a documentary exhibition dedicated to the 140th anniversary of the birth of the classic Belarusian literary figure, Zmitser Byadulya, was on display. Students were able to view unique manuscripts, photographs, letters, and other documents revealing the writer’s life and career.

The «Archives for School» campaign continues its mission to popularize knowledge among young people about the cultural history of Belarus and the role of archives in society.
